EXCEEDS logo
Exceeds
JamesTessmer

PROFILE

Jamestessmer

Over a two-month period, contributed to the microbiomedata/nmdc-server repository by delivering eight new features focused on improving user experience, data discoverability, and maintainability. Developed a dedicated submission creation flow and overhauled the portal’s UI using Vue.js and TypeScript, introducing reusable components and migrating data models to JSON for consistency. Enhanced navigation and clarified UX messaging to reduce user friction. Implemented end-to-end search functionality in the submission list, updating both API and frontend layers with Python and SQL. Improved form validation and code hygiene, resulting in a more reliable, scalable, and user-friendly submission portal for scientific data management.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

19Total
Bugs
0
Commits
19
Features
8
Lines of code
1,936
Activity Months2

Work History

February 2026

9 Commits • 4 Features

Feb 1, 2026

February 2026 performance summary for microbiomedata/nmdc-server. Delivered core product improvements across search, UI clarity, and data validation with targeted code hygiene, enabling faster data discovery, fewer user errors, and easier maintenance.

January 2026

10 Commits • 4 Features

Jan 1, 2026

January 2026 — microbiomedata/nmdc-server: Completed major UX and architecture improvements for the submission portal, including a dedicated Submission Creation Page, enhanced navigation, clarified UX messaging, and a UI overhaul with reusable components and a data-model migration to JSON. These changes reduce user friction, improve throughput, and establish a scalable, consistent UI foundation across the portal.

Activity

Loading activity data...

Quality Metrics

Correctness97.8%
Maintainability91.6%
Architecture91.6%
Performance91.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

JavaScriptPythonSQLTypeScriptVue

Technical Skills

API developmentAPI integrationPythonPython programmingSQLSQL scriptingTypeScriptUI/UX designVueVue.jsbackend developmentcomponent architecturecomponent designdatabase managementfront end development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

microbiomedata/nmdc-server

Jan 2026 Feb 2026
2 Months active

Languages Used

JavaScriptPythonSQLTypeScriptVue

Technical Skills

API integrationPython programmingSQL scriptingTypeScriptUI/UX designVue